Timo Werner arrives in Leipzig ahead of his medical TODAY with the forward set to complete a £25m move back to the German club only two years after he left for Chelsea

  • RB Leipzig have struck a deal with Chelsea to re-sign Timo Werner
  • The German striker is set to move to the Bundesliga club for £25.3million
  • Chelsea bought Werner for £47.5m back in 2020, but he has failed to deliver 
  • They are now set to take a major financial hit on the 26-year-old striker

Timo Werner has arrived in Leipzig ahead of his permanent move back to the club only two years after leaving for Chelsea.

Chelsea and RB Leipzig have agreed a fee of around £25million including add-ons for Germany forward Werner who will have a medical on Tuesday before the move is confirmed.

Werner, 26, spent a prolific four years at Leipzig before moving to Chelsea, scoring 95 goals in just 159 games.

Timo Werner has agreed to rejoin RB Leipzig just two years after leaving the club

Thomas Tuchel has struggled to get the best out of Werner during his time at Stamford Bridge

Werner joined Chelsea for £47.5m in 2020 and has scored 23 goals and set up a further 21 in 89 appearances.

But, after a first year in which he featured regularly, his involvement dropped significantly under Thomas Tuchel.

Werner expressed his desire to play more often during Chelsea’s pre-season tour of America, particularly ahead of the World Cup in November.

Newcastle and Juventus were also keen on Werner but a move back to his former side has emerged as his preferred option.

While it was expected that a loan move would be sanctioned the two clubs have thrashed out a permanent move allowing Chelsea to recoup some of their outlay two years ago and amid their own spree this summer.

Werner has struggled to deliver consistently for Chelsea during his time in England

They have spent around £175m already on Raheem Sterling, Kalidou Koulibaly, Gabriel Slonina and Marc Cucurella. And with Leicester’s Wesley Fofana, Barcelona’s Frenkie de Jong and a striker also on their wish list that figure would pass £300m before sales if they land their targets.

Barcelona’s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ang has been offered to Chelsea, who are also battling Manchester United, among others, for RB Salzburg striker starlet Benjamin Sesko.

There are set to be further departures with Marcos Alonso close to a move to Barcelona, Callum Hudson-Odoi hoping to seal a loan move away before the end of the window and Hakim Ziyech, Kepa Arrizabalaga and Malang Sarr among those also with uncertain futures.
